Output 0c9c66c3d841fd81adbddbaf43b32c4a7e0cb570f07d9450b718036fc7120401:22

value
1032839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ae34975cd34bb18b804ffcda837572636ec58b7 OP_EQUAL
address
32gaxdsJmK5sUiRQCmRQeYWEr1P5TRUsWu
transaction
0c9c66c3d841fd81adbddbaf43b32c4a7e0cb570f07d9450b718036fc7120401
spent
true